Question:
What is the Pololu Mini Maestro 18-Channel USB Servo Controller?
Answer: The Pololu Mini Maestro 18-Channel USB Servo Controller is a compact device designed to control a wide range of servos and other components via USB. It offers 18 channels that can be independently controlled using standard servo commands. This flexibility makes it ideal for robotics projects, animatronics, and custom controls in various applications. -
Question:
How does the Mini Maestro 18-Channel USB Servo Controller work?
Answer: The Mini Maestro operates by accepting commands sent from a computer via USB, which dictates the position and movement of the connected servos. It includes a scripting language for more complex sequences and automation. Users can program it using the Maestro Control Center software, which provides a user-friendly interface to configure and send commands. -
Question:
What are the key features of the Pololu Mini Maestro?
Answer: Key features of the Pololu Mini Maestro include 18 servo channels, support for 0.5 ms to 2.5 ms pulse widths, compatibility with USB for easy connection, and onboard scripting capabilities. This makes it suited for a range of applications from simple projects to advanced robotics integrating multiple moving parts. -

What types of servos can I control with the Mini Maestro?
Answer: You can control both standard hobby servos and continuous rotation servos with the Mini Maestro 18-Channel USB Servo Controller. This versatility makes it an excellent choice for projects requiring precise positioning or continuous motion, such as robotic arms, mobile robots, and animatronic figures. -
Question:
Is external power required for the servos connected to the Mini Maestro?
Answer: Yes, an external power supply is recommended for the servos connected to the Mini Maestro to prevent excessive current draw from the USB. This is crucial for ensuring stable operation when using multiple servos or high-torque models, as the external power supports the demands of the project without affecting the controller's performance. -

Features & Benefits
- 0.25μs resolution with built-in speed and acceleration control
- Pulse rates up to 333 Hz
- Can be used as a general I/O controller
- Compact and versatile device
- Partial kit version includes header pins
- Surface-mount components are soldered
